4. Plant Care Insights
-
Sunlight: Thrives best in full sun for abundant flowering.
-
Soil: Prefers well-drained soil and adapts well to average garden conditions.
-
Watering: Water moderately; allow soil to dry slightly between watering.
-
Companions: Pairs beautifully with marigolds, zinnias, cosmos, and other sun-loving cottage flowers.
-
Maintenance: Remove faded blooms occasionally to keep plants looking fresh and encourage more flowers.
Frequently Asked Questions – Vinca Seeds
Q1. Do Vinca plants continue blooming throughout the season?
Yes, they are known for long-lasting, continuous flowering.
They keep producing blooms through warm weather with steady care.
Q2. Are Vinca flowers suitable for dry or low-water gardens?
Yes, they are quite tolerant once well established.
They handle dry spells better than many seasonal flowers.
Q3. Can Vinca be used in decorative garden borders?
Yes, their neat growth makes them ideal for edging and borders.
They create clean, colorful lines in cottage-style gardens.
Q4. Do Vinca plants grow well alongside other flowering plants?
Yes, they combine easily with many summer garden flowers.
Their steady blooms help balance mixed planting designs.
